Forensic telepsychiatry in the United Kingdom
Younus Saleem1, Mark H Taylor, Najat Khalifa
1North Nottinghamshire Community Forensic Service, Nottinghamshire Healthcare NHS Trust, Nottingham, UK. younus.saleem@nottshc.nhs.uk
Abstract:
Forensic telepsychiatry remains in its infancy in the United Kingdom. This article sets out to describe how it can be used within a community forensic service, and the future challenges ahead in the United Kingdom. It looks at relevant academic, governmental, and legal resources and is designed as a scholarly reflection by clinicians rather than as a formal literature review.
